We consider a defect in a strongly correlated host metal and discuss, within a slave boson mean field formalism for the $t-t'-J$ model, the formation of an induced paramagnetic moment which is extended over nearby sites. We study in particular an impurity in a metallic band, suitable for modelling the optimally doped cuprates, in a regime where the impurity moment is paramagnetic. The form of the local susceptibility as a function of temperature and doping is found to agree well with recent NMR experiments, without including screening processes leading to the Kondo effect.
